Steps to Cancel Your Walmart Membership

There are two ways to cancel your Walmart membership:

1. Cancelling Online

The first step is to log in to your Walmart account. Once you have logged in, navigate to the membership section and select “Cancel Membership.” You will be prompted to provide a reason for canceling your membership. Once you have provided the reason, click on “Cancel Membership” again to confirm. Your membership will be canceled immediately, and you will receive a confirmation email.

2. Cancelling in Store

If you prefer to cancel your membership in person, you can visit your nearest Walmart store. Go to the customer service desk and ask for assistance in canceling your membership. You will be asked to provide your membership details and a reason for canceling. Once the cancellation is processed, you will receive a confirmation email.
